Service Check Function
Check Method 1
1. When the timer cancel button is held down for 5 seconds, 00 is displayed on the temperature display screen.
2. Press the timer cancel button repeatedly until a long beep sounds.
The code indication changes in the sequence shown below.
Note: 1. A short beep or two consecutive beeps indicate non-corresponding codes.
2. To return to the normal mode, hold the timer cancel button down for 5 seconds. When the remote controller is left untouched for 60 seconds, it also returns to the normal mode.
3. Not all the error codes are displayed. When you cannot find the error code, try the check method 2. (Refer to page 92.)
Check Method 2 1. Press the 3 buttons (TEMP, TEMP, MODE) at the same time to enter the diagnosis mode.
The left-side number blinks.
Sound Blanket Removal
Warning: Be sure to wait for 10 minutes or more after turning off all power supplies before disassembling work.
Open the sound blanket (outer)
Remove the sound blanket (top upper)
The sound blanket is fragile. Carefully pass the discharge pipe through it.
Remove the screw and slightly push the partition plate (1) to the left for easy work.
Remove the sound blanket (outer)
Open the sound blanket (inner)
Remove the sound blanket (inner)
The sound blanket is fragile. Be careful of the notches of the compressor mount (4 locations).
Inverter Checker Check
Warning: This procedure requires trained personnel with PPE!
Power turned off
Install the inverter checker instead of a compressor
Charged voltage of the built-in smoothing electrolytic capacitor dropped to 10 VDC or below
Terminals removed from the compressor
Terminals connected to the terminals of the inverter checker
Warning: Do not let the terminals (U,V,W) touch each other. High voltage is applied
Power transistor test operation activated from the outdoor unit
Diagnose according to 6 LEDs lighting status
Fan Motor Connector Output Check
FTXS series
Check the connection of connector
Check the motor power supply voltage output (pins 4 - 7)
Check the motor control voltage (pins 4 - 3)
Check the rotation command voltage (pins 4 - 2)
Check the rotation pulse (pins 4 - 1)

Electrical Box Removal
Warning: Be sure to wait for 10 minutes or more after turning off all power supplies before disassembling work.
Remove the screw on the stop valve mounting plate.
Remove the screw on the partition plate (1).
Remove the 2 screws to detach the ground wires.
Disconnect the connector for fan motor [S70] and release the 4 clamps attached to the electrical box.
Release the fan motor lead wire.
Disconnect the connectors of the front side.
The compressor lead wire is fixed on the partition plate (1) with a clamp.
Pull out the clamp and release the compressor lead wire.
